Agreement of Merger between Bay-Micro Computers, Inc., a California corporation, and BMC Acquisition Corporation, a Delaware corporation, dated November 12, 1999. 4 pages. By pooling resources, expertise, and customer bases, the companies aim to maximize efficiency, unlock synergies, and drive future growth. 3. Agreement Types: a. Horizontal Merger Agreement: A horizontally structured merger agreement refers to the integration of two companies operating in the same industry or providing similar products/services. In this case, Bay Micro Computers, Inc. and BMC Acquisition Corporation, both being technology firms, might enter into a horizontal merger agreement to consolidate their market presence and expand their offerings. b. Vertical Merger Agreement: A vertical merger agreement involves the merger of companies operating at different stages of the value chain or offering complementary products/services. If Bay Micro Computers, Inc., a manufacturer, were to acquire BMC Acquisition Corporation, a software developer, they would form a vertical merger aimed at streamlining operations and delivering end-to-end solutions. c. Conglomerate Merger Agreement: A conglomerate merger agreement occurs when two companies from unrelated industries join forces to diversify their operations and expand their market reach. Although less likely in the case of Bay Micro Computers, Inc. and BMC Acquisition Corporation, this type of merger could take place if the companies sought to venture into a completely different market sector. 4.
